Generally, a special event policy covers two things:

  • Cancellation coverage. This covers the costs relating to postponing the event instead of just canceling the event outright. It can also cover the costs you face if the event goes ahead but you have to spend extra money because a supplier or venue lets you down.
  • Liability coverage. This coverage protects against any claims you face for property damage or injury related to the event. This could include injuries to venue staff or guests at the event. Liability coverage is often required by venues.

You should also find out if the policy covers alcohol-related incidents. The coverage could vary depending on whether or not guests are paying for their drinks.
